TAEMUN 2020

For the past 17 years, our institution has had a Model of United Nations (MUN), a simulation of the debates that are held in the international organization of the United Nations. In TAEMUN, students from elementary through high school and college worked as delegates of a country, defended their official position in the different committees that revolved around the Sustainable Development Goals 20- 30.

The development of these debates took place from February 6th-8th this year, where 18 educational institutions in Mexico City participated, along with our elementary, middle, and high school. In total, we had over 335 delegates. In the Opening Ceremony, Sandra Camacho, TAE alumni and former munner, participated. As a student, she was part of our first Model of United Nations. She currently is a Senior Advisor at the Private Sector Alliance for Disaster Resilient Societies (ARISE) for the UN’s Office for Disaster Risk Reduction (UNDRR). In the Closing Ceremony, Cinthia Isabel Flores, Puebla’s State Prize and National Youth Prize in 2017 in the Environment Protection by the Federal Government. Thanks to the collaboration and support of TAE’s community, the event was successful.
